Over and Under and Combined Score Markets Explained
When the winner of a match feels too difficult to predict, the over/under market presents a welcome alternative that concentrates entirely on the quantity of action rather than its direction. The sportsbook establishes a baseline number, commonly for goals in football or points in basketball, and the bettor chooses whether the combined total will exceed or fall short of that line. A classic football total line is often set at 2.5 goals, a clever threshold that removes the possibility of a push since half-goals do not exist. Betting over 2.5 means hoping for three or more goals regardless of which team scores them, transforming any attacking move into a moment of excitement. The under 2.5 bet generates a different kind of tension, where every defensive clearance and wasted chance seems like a small victory.
The genius of totals markets rests in their detachment from emotional bias. A fan who cannot bear to bet against their beloved team can instead bet on a high-scoring spectacle or a tactical stalemate. Incaspin Casino offers a wide spectrum of total lines beyond the standard 2.5, including alternative lines like over 1.5 for a safer but lower-odds option, or over 3.5 for thrill-seekers chasing bigger payouts. The same logic applies to corners, cards, and even individual player statistics in more advanced setups. To consistently analyze totals, bettors evaluate a blend of factors:
- Scoring firepower — goals per game, shot conversion rates, and recent scoring form.
- Defensive leaks — clean sheet percentages, injuries to key defenders, and high-line vulnerability.
- Game context — a relegation scrap often produces tight, low-scoring affairs, while a mid-table clash with nothing to lose opens the game up.
- External conditions — heavy rain, swirling wind, or a lenient referee can nudge a total line higher or lower.
Learning to read these contextual clues reveals a market where the scoreboard matters more than the badge on the jersey.
The Primary Match Result and Outright Markets
The 1X2 market, often just called match result, is the clear king of sports betting and the perfect starting point for any newcomer. In a football context, 1 signifies a home win, X indicates a draw, and 2 indicates an away victory. This clean structure encompasses every potential outcome of the regular game duration, leaving no ambiguity. The odds for each option offer a clear picture of the expected balance of power. A heavily favored home side might bbc.co.uk show 1.40, while the draw sits at 4.50 and the away win stretches to 7.00. Making a bet here means committing to a clear narrative: one team will control, or neither will break the deadlock. The simplicity is tricky, because examining form, injuries, and head-to-head records turns this basic market into a complex strategic puzzle.

Handicap Betting and the Craft of Equalizing the Field
Handicap betting addresses one of the oldest frustrations in sports wagering: the lopsided contest where betting on the heavy favorite yields tiny returns and wagering on the underdog feels like charity. The sportsbook assigns a virtual deficit or head start to balance the playing field, producing a scenario where both sides present attractive, competitive odds. In a European handicap, a strong home team might start the match trailing by a full goal, implying they must win by two clear goals for the bet to win. Conversely, the underdog gets a one-goal cushion, so a narrow defeat or any draw still provides a winning ticket. This mechanism injects drama into mismatches, because the scoreboard must be read through the lens of the adjusted line. A casual 2-0 victory becomes a nail-biter when the favorite needs a third to cover the handicap. The most common handicap structures include:
- European handicap — a simple whole-goal or whole-point start that still enables a draw after the adjustment.
- Asian handicap — lines like -0.25, -0.75 or +1.25 that split stakes and erase the draw, providing partial wins and refunds.
- Alternative handicap — custom lines such as -2.5 or +3.5 that enable bettors tailor the level of risk and reward to their conviction.
Asian handicaps enhance this concept further by introducing quarter-goal and half-goal lines that remove the draw possibility entirely. A -0.25 handicap divides the stake between two virtual bets, generating partial wins and losses that diminish the black-and-white brutality of traditional betting. The -0.75 line necessitates a two-goal victory for a full payout, while a one-goal win produces a half-profit. These intricate structures appeal to analytical bettors who value granular risk management. Decoding the 3 Classic Odds Formats
Before exploring market types, every beginner needs to decipher odds presentation, which differs by region but always delivers the same core information. Decimal odds are the simplest and widely used internationally, presenting the total payout per unit staked, counting the original stake. A decimal quote of 2.50 means a successful ten-unit bet returns twenty-five units in total. Fractional odds, favored in traditional circles, indicate the potential profit relative to the stake, so 3/1 means three units of profit for every one unit wagered. American odds use positive and negative numbers to show underdogs and favorites respectively, with +200 reflecting the 3/1 fractional concept. The key insight is that no format is superior; they are simply different dialects of the same language. Here is how the same winning wager is shown across the three systems:
- Decimal: 2.50 — multiply your stake to see the total return (10 × 2.50 = 25).
- Fractional: 3/1 — profit of three units for each one staked, and your stake back.
- American: +200 — a positive number shows the profit on a 100-unit bet, so +200 gives 200 profit.
Mastering decimal odds gives the quickest path to intuitive understanding because the multiplication is instant. If a bettor sees 1.80 for a tennis favorite, they immediately know a modest return awaits, signaling high probability. When the underdog sits at 3.40, the larger number signals a smaller chance of victory but a juicier reward.
